继发于坚固内固定材料应力的下颌后支边缘垂直骨折。

Vertical fracture of the mandibular posterior ramus border secondary to the stress of the rigid internal fixation material.

Abstract

A unique case of a vertical fracture of the mandibular posterior ramus border secondary to the stress of the rigid internal fixation material is described in this study. We think that the surgeon's experience and awareness play a key role in avoidance of such a complication.

摘要

本研究描述了一例因坚固内固定材料应力导致下颌后支边缘垂直骨折的独特病例。我们认为外科医生的经验和意识在避免此类并发症方面起着关键作用。
